A shop has a sale that offers 20% of all prices.
Nana76 [90]
<h2>Greetings!</h2>

Answer:

40% reduction

Step-by-step explanation:

To answert this, we need to find how much of the price is each percentage. This can be found my subtracting the percent from 100:

Sale price: 100 - 20 = 80

Last day price: 100 - 25 = 75

Now we need to multiply these two values together, remembering to divide both numbers by 100 first:

80 ÷ 100 = 0.8

75 ÷ 100 = 0.75

0.8 * 0.75 = 0.6

Then multiply by 100 to find the percentage:

0.6 * 100 = 60

60% is the end price, but to find the overall reduction we need to subtract this value from 100:

100 - 60 = 40

So there was a 40% reduction on the price.
